Manjaro 15.12 update-pack 2:
Included in this update:
Plasma 5.5.2
dbus 1.10.6
thunderbird 38.5
mesa 11.1.0
Supported kernels:
Linux310 3.10.94
Linux312 3.12.51
Linux313 3.13.11.32
Linux314 3.14.58
Linux316 3.16.7.21
Linux318 3.18.25
Linux319 3.19.8.12
Linux41 4.1.15
Linux42 4.2.8
Linux43 4.3.3
Linux44 4.4-rc7
This update also includes the usual Archlinux upstream fixes as of Thu. Dec 28, 2015
You can use Muon Update, Octopi, or the CLI (command line) to perform this update:
sudo pacman -Syu

After the update, when I try to launch Konsole, its windows appears and then suddenly disappears.
If I lauch it from yakuake I obtain This error message:
QCoreApplication::arguments: Please instantiate the QApplication object first
QDBusConnection: session D-Bus connection created before QCoreApplication. Application may misbehave.

That is strange, those errors are actually normal when you launch konsole from within a terminal.
However, the konsole window should stay open.
Thanks a lot. I solved this issue: I removed the file .config/konsolerc and now konsole is working again.
